Method 1: Harnessing Progressive Web Apps (PWAs) and Browser Shortcuts

Modern web browsers like Google Chrome, Microsoft Edge, and even Brave and Firefox (with varying degrees of support for PWAs) offer features that can transform any website into a standalone desktop application. This is arguably the closest you can get to an "official" "claude for desktop" experience without requiring a dedicated installer.

How PWAs Emulate a Desktop App:

When you "install" a PWA or create a site shortcut, the browser essentially wraps the website in its own application window. This window typically: * Removes the browser's address bar and toolbar, giving it a cleaner, app-like appearance. * Appears as its own application in your operating system's taskbar/dock and application switcher. * Can be launched directly from your desktop, start menu, or applications folder. * Often allows for native desktop notifications and background processes (though this depends on the website's capabilities and browser implementation).

Step-by-Step Guide for Creating a "Claude Desktop" PWA/Shortcut:

For Google Chrome (Windows, macOS, Linux):

  1. Open Claude's Web Interface: Navigate to the official Claude web interface (e.g., claude.ai or your specific access point) in Chrome. Ensure you are logged in.
  2. Access the "Install" Option: In the top-right corner of Chrome, click the three-dot menu (More options).
  3. Find "Install Claude" or "Create Shortcut": Look for an option like "Install Claude" or "More Tools" -> "Create shortcut...".
    • If "Install Claude" is available (indicating it's recognized as a PWA), click it. A confirmation dialog will appear. Click "Install."
    • If only "Create shortcut..." is available, click that. A dialog box will appear.
  4. Configure Shortcut (if applicable): In the "Create shortcut?" dialog, name it something clear like "Claude" or "Claude AI." Crucially, check the "Open as window" box. This is what makes it behave like a standalone app.
  5. Launch Your "Claude Desktop": After installation/creation, Chrome will typically launch the new app in its own window. You'll find an icon in your applications folder, start menu, or on your desktop, allowing you to launch it directly whenever you need your "claude for desktop."

For Microsoft Edge (Windows, macOS, Linux):

  1. Open Claude's Web Interface: Navigate to the official Claude web interface in Edge. Ensure you are logged in.
  2. Access the "Apps" Menu: In the top-right corner of Edge, click the three-dot menu (Settings and more).
  3. Find "Install this site as an app": Hover over "Apps" and then select "Install this site as an app."
  4. Confirm Installation: A dialog box will appear asking you to confirm the app name (e.g., "Claude"). Click "Install."
  5. Customize (Optional): Edge often offers further customization options after installation, such as pinning to the taskbar, start menu, or creating a desktop shortcut. Select your preferences.
  6. Launch Your "Claude Desktop": Edge will launch the new Claude app in a dedicated window. You can now access "claude desktop" directly from your chosen locations.

This PWA/shortcut method offers a robust and officially supported way to get a "claude for desktop" feel, providing a clean interface, quick access, and minimizing browser tab clutter.

2. API Key Management (for custom integrations)

If you're using Claude's API to build custom desktop applications, securing your API keys is paramount.

  • Never Hardcode API Keys: Do not embed API keys directly into your application's source code, especially if it's distributed.
  • Environment Variables: Store API keys as environment variables on the system where the application runs.
  • Secret Management Services: For enterprise-level deployments, use dedicated secret management services (e.g., AWS Secrets Manager, HashiCorp Vault) to dynamically retrieve API keys.
  • Rate Limiting and Monitoring: Implement rate limiting on your API calls to prevent abuse and monitor API usage for any suspicious activity.
